About DiMarzio
DiMarzio is a name synonymous with high-performance guitar and bass pickups, revered by players and luthiers alike for their innovative designs and powerful tones. Founded in the 1970s, the company quickly gained prominence by offering pickups that delivered a distinctive voice, often pushing the boundaries of what was expected from electric instruments. DiMarzio’s legacy is built on collaboration with legendary guitarists and a relentless pursuit of sonic excellence.

Frequently Asked Questions About DiMarzio
DiMarzio pickups are primarily manufactured in their factory in Hamden, Connecticut, USA, with a focus on quality control and meticulous craftsmanship.
DiMarzio offers both active and passive pickups. Passive pickups are traditional and rely on the guitar's electronics, while active pickups have onboard circuitry and require a battery for power.
DiMarzio pickups are generally recognized for their high output and distinct tonal character, often providing a more aggressive and articulate sound than some vintage-voiced alternatives.
